Damien 28th June 2007 09:43

I'm very happy, I've just finished the first part of the new dashboard of my Mosquito.

I make the same than the original one, in fiber glass, but this one is in machined alloy. Instruments will be fitted as in classic Minis.
I've fitted the chrome ring to add a "Mini touch":icon_wink:

You might wonder why the dashboard is black... It's just a black plastic fitted to protect the panel. I don't want to remove it as long as the dashboard isn't finished.

Damien 12th December 2007 09:22

I've drilled holes for rear lights and the suspension has been modified. The shock absorber has changed and is now outside the chassis. The first solution wasn't effective at all :biggrin1:

Rear lights would have look nicer if fitted lower but because of the shock absorber, it wasn't possible...

I've also removed the spare wheel as it was not very beautiful.
